Orion Printex F80 Carbon Black

Orion Printex F80 Carbon Black is a high-structure, oil furnace–produced pigment from Orion Engineered Carbons’ Printex® series. Designed for demanding gravure and flexographic inks, it delivers exceptional jetness, dispersion stability, and rheology control. Its optimized particle size and surface chemistry ensure superior print quality, gloss, and conductivity in specialty coatings and conductive applications.

Features Of Orion Printex F80 Carbon Black

  1. High structure morphology enabling excellent conductivity and dispersion stability in aqueous systems.

  2. Consistent particle size distribution with low surface oxygen content for enhanced ink jet performance.

  3. Optimized pH and surface chemistry for compatibility with acrylic and styrene-acrylic polymer dispersions.

  4. Low abrasivity minimizing wear on print heads and coating equipment during high-speed ink manufacturing.

  5. Reproducible batch-to-batch quality meeting stringent OEM ink formulation requirements.

Typical Applications Of Orion Printex F80 Carbon Black

  1. Aqueous pigment inkjet inks for office and industrial wide-format printing.

  2. Water-based gravure and flexographic packaging inks.

  3. Conductive coatings for flexible electronics and antistatic layers.

  4. Specialty waterborne architectural and decorative coatings requiring neutral gray tone and gloss retention.

  5. Functional colorants in textile printing pastes for polyester and cotton blends.

Specifications Of Orion Printex F80 Carbon Black

Chemical TypeCarbon black (furnace process)
Product FormFree-flowing dry powder, pelletized or slurry-ready
AppearanceBlack granular powder
Primary ApplicationsAqueous inkjet inks, water-based packaging inks, conductive coatings
Key FeaturesHigh structure, low surface oxygen, neutral pH (~7.0–8.5), excellent wetting in water
BenefitsImproved jetting reliability, reduced nozzle clogging, stable rheology, minimal filter pressure rise
Storage StabilityStable under dry, cool, and well-ventilated conditions; avoid moisture absorption
